An experimenter finds that students in a morning class perform better on a math test after being taught with a new teaching method compared with students in an afternoon class who are taught with a standard teaching method. He concludes that the new teaching method is superior to the old method. The main problem with this experimenter's conclusion is:

Post-Traumatic Stress

An emotional and mental disorder resulting from living through or seeing a distressing event, leading to persistent flashbacks, nightmares, and overwhelming worry.

Social Phobias

Intense, persistent, and irrational fears of social or performance situations where embarrassment may occur, leading to significant anxiety and avoidance behavior.

Specific Phobias

Intense, irrational fears of specific objects or situations, significantly impacting an individual's daily life.

Somatoform Disorder

A mental disorder that causes individuals to experience physical symptoms that have no identifiable physical cause, believed to be linked to psychological factors.
